Spartan Delta Corp. (OTCMKTS:DALXF – Get Free Report) was the target of a significant drop in short interest in January. As of January 31st, there was short interest totalling 1,348,700 shares, a drop of 24.3% from the January 15th total of 1,782,800 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 77,800 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 17.3 days.
Spartan Delta Trading Up 0.5 %
DALXF stock opened at $2.64 on Friday. Spartan Delta has a 52-week low of $2.03 and a 52-week high of $3.16. The firm has a 50 day moving average price of $2.50 and a 200-day moving average price of $2.63.
